Abstract
PURPOSE: To obtain a chloride of an element of the III or V group of periodic table in high yield, by heat-treating granular active carbon soaked in an aqueous solution of a compound of an element belonging to the III, IV, or V group of periodic table under inert gas atmosphere at specific temperature, followed by reacting the compound supported on the active carbon with chlorine.
CONSTITUTION: Granular active carbon is soaked in an aqueous solution of a compound (except chloride and boric acid) of an element selected from the III, IV, or V group of periodic table and the compound is suported on the active carbon. The granular active carbon is heat-treated under inert gas atmosphere at 300W1,000°C, and the granular active carbon after heat treatment is reacted with chlorine on a fixed bed or fluidized bed, to give the desired chloride of the element of the III, IV, or V group of periodic table, e.g., boron trichloride, boron tetrachloride, zirconium tetrachloride, vanadium tetrachloride.
